In the rap lyrics the pretty woman in the first verse becomes "big hairy … Witryna17 kwi 2024 · Sampling is the process of using portions of an existing audio recording in a new recording. Samples can be anything that has been recorded, including music, dialogue, sound effects and more. Samples can be used in a variety of ways: as musical accompaniment for an entirely new track, as snippets of spoken or sung phrases or …
